Before operation

Turning on/off the unit

Press DVD STANDBY/ON
When the unit turns on, the STANDBY/ON indicator on the front panel, which illuminates in red during standby, lights in
green.

When turning on the unit for the first time, the DVD PLAYER SET UP display automatically appears (see page 15).
